About Us

Move money. Make money. Finix is a full-stack acquirer processor, empowering businesses of all sizes with flexible, modern payment solutions. Processing billions of dollars annually, Finix enables SaaS, marketplace, and e-commerce platforms to accept payments, manage payouts, and onboard merchants seamlessly. With our no-code, low-code, and developer-friendly tools, businesses can get up and running in hours—not months.


Finix has raised over $175M, including a $75M Series C led by Acrew Capital, with participation from Lightspeed Venture Partners, Leap Global, American Express Ventures, Bain Capital Ventures, Homebrew, Inspired Capital, Sequoia Capital, Visa, and others.


About the role:


At Finix, we build for scale and develop systems that can process tens of thousands of events per second. Our systems move millions of dollars per day. We iterate quickly and constantly release new features with little to no margin for error.


As a member of the Support Engineering Team, you are the front line and the face of Finix. You will interact with customers daily and help them on their path to becoming payment facilitators, all while simultaneously improving the product through feature requests.  This is a cross-functional role and you will be collaborating across multiple teams including but not limited to our Revenue, Product, and Engineering teams.


We are looking for a candidate who is a payment nerd or is interested in being one. Additionally,  successful candidates are natural problem-solvers and show a curiosity about how the industry works. They are excited to help our customers build their own perfect payments stack.


This hybrid role entails working in the office 4 days per week in our San Francisco HQ. 


You will:

  • Collaborate with the Revenue, Product, and Engineering teams on projects, features, and tasks along with managing the Hubspot queue and answering tickets
  • Troubleshoot, debug, and document technical customer issues and solutions 
  • Build strong relationships with Finix users, work with them to resolve their issues including identifying product gaps and enhancement, and work to implement solutions and improvements
  • Act as a customer advocate in cross-functional product meetings 
  • Engage and participate in team learnings to better understand the payments ecosystem

You have:

  • BS/MS in Computer Science, Engineering, or similar experience (Open to DevBootcamp graduates and non-college graduates) 
  • Experience working with RESTful JSON APIs, Curl Commands, SQL, scripting languages, debugging, log aggregators, and web technologies 
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ills. You believe in being open, honest, and direct in your communications
  • Comfortable working in a fast pace environment and interacting with a high volume of customers every day, team-oriented, and hungry to learn
  • Strong foundational knowledge of APIs and can explain the concept to a five-year-old easily
  • Experience with ticketing tools such as Hubspot

Bonus points if you have:

  • Previous experience working for SaaS companies
  • Payments experience
  • Python, Ruby, and/or JavaScript experience

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
